Starting off with when to start your sales. This is a question we get asked frequently and the answer is simply, it depends. It depends on the growth stage of your business, your margins, how much you’re spending on paid channels, and how promotional you want to be. One thing we cannot stress enough, is that during Q4 and especially around the major shopping holidays, like Black Friday, you HAVE to run a promotion because consumers expect it.
They expect them because of the holiday and not because your business has historically run them, so if the fear is that you don’t want to train consumers to wait and purchase during a sale – well you can get that fear out of your head. They expect a sale due to it being a shopping holiday and are going to buy and prioritize brands who are running a promo over a brand that isn’t. So plan to at least have a sale running on Black Friday thru Cyber Monday, we encourage a pre-Black Friday and an end of year sale to clear excess inventory but those aren’t necessary.
Now with the added challenge of it being an election year and candidates HEAVILY spending I would say to hold on any major sales and spending until after the election on 11/4 due to the increase in cost per mille (CPM’s) on paid social channels.
